This Garlic Parmesan Pasta with Roasted Vegetables is a simple yet flavorful dish that combines al dente pasta with a rich garlic and Parmesan sauce complemented by a medley of roasted vegetables.
Perfect for a quick dinner for two this recipe is easy to prepare and can be customized with your favorite seasonal vegetables.

Quick Garlic Parmesan Pasta Recipe

This dish features pasta tossed in a creamy garlic Parmesan sauce, paired with roasted bell peppers, zucchini, and cherry tomatoes. The recipe takes about 30 minutes to prepare and serves 2 people.
Ingredients
- 8 oz pasta of your choice (spaghetti, penne, etc.)
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 medium zucchini, diced
- 1 bell pepper, diced
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Roast the Vegetables: On a baking sheet, toss the cherry tomatoes, zucchini, and bell pepper with 2 tablespoons of olive oil, salt, and pepper. Roast in the oven for 20 minutes until tender.
- Cook the Pasta: While the vegetables are roasting, c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
- Prepare the Sauce: In a large skillet,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
- Combine: Add the cooked pasta to the skillet, along with the roasted vegetables and Parmesan cheese. Toss everything together until well combined. Adjust seasoning with salt and pepper.
- Serve: Plate the pasta and garnish with fresh parsley if desired. Serve hot.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Servings: 2 servings
- Calories: 450kcal
- Fat: 18g
- Protein: 15g
- Carbohydrates: 60g
